Top 5 City Building Games on iOS in Europe Q3 2021
Discover the performance of the top city building games on iOS in Europe during Q3 2021, including trends in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
In the third quarter of 2021, the top city building games on iOS in Europe showcased intriguing tr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. Here’s a closer look at the performance of these popular games, based on data from Sensor Tower.
SimCity BuildIt by Electronic Arts saw a varied performance in weekly revenue, peaking at around $119.5K in mid-July and maintaining a generally steady range between $85K and $115K throughout the quarter. Weekly downloads fluctuated, reaching a high of approximately 48.5K in mid-September, while active users showed a slight decline from 316.7K to 291.5K by the end of the quarter.
The Simpsons™: Tapped Out, also from Electronic Arts, experienced notable revenue peaks, particularly in early August with around $77.4K. Downloads were relatively stable, with a slight uptick to 20K in late September. Active users hovered around the 300K mark, indicating a consistent player base.
The Tribez: Build a Village from Game Insight displayed modest revenue, peaking at over $22K at the start of the quarter. Downloads were quite low throughout, with a notable increase to 5.2K in early August. Active users saw a gradual decline from 8.8K to around 8K by the quarter's end.
Global City: Building Games by MY.GAMES B.V. showed impressive growth in both revenue and downloads. The game’s revenue peaked at approximately $19.4K in late August, while downloads surged to 32.2K during the same period. Active users also saw a significant increase, reaching a peak of 37.5K at the end of August.
Sid Meier's Civilization® VI by Aspyr Media, Inc. had a relatively stable performance. Revenue peaked at around $24.1K in late August, with weekly downloads remaining consistent, averaging around 3K. Active users saw a slight decline from 6.4K to 5.1K over the quarter.
